The
Lupus Foundation of Colorado has opportunities for volunteers to become
involved and to be able to give back in rewarding ways.
Support
Group Facilitators
Support
Group facilitators are people with Lupus who have an interest in group
facilitation and have the time and motivation to make a commitment to
group leadership, making a difference in the lives of many. Training for
facilitators is available.
Peer
Mentors
This
is a special program that enables volunteers to provide supportive services
on a one-on-one basis to individuals diagnosed with Lupus. Peer mentors
help others mainly through phone support.

Health
Fairs
Health
fairs are a great way of raising public awareness and creating outreach
regarding Lupus. Volunteers are needed in communities throughout Colorado
to represent the Lupus Foundation at local health fairs
General
Office Support
We
rely on volunteers to assist us with the preparation and distribution
of information packets, copying and filing and assistance with special
mailings. Volunteers also assist with membership.
